Docsity
Docsity

Prepara tus exámenes
Prepara tus exámenes

Prepara tus exámenes y mejora tus resultados gracias a la gran cantidad de recursos disponibles en Docsity


Consigue puntos base para descargar
Consigue puntos base para descargar

Gana puntos ayudando a otros estudiantes o consíguelos activando un Plan Premium


Orientación Universidad
Orientación Universidad


iNTRODUCCION A HERRAMIENTAS COMPUTACIONALES, Diapositivas de Computación aplicada

SOFTWARE LIBRE Y OPEN SOURCE, DEBATE Y DIFERENCIAS

Tipo: Diapositivas

2019/2020

Subido el 15/09/2020

mareregu
mareregu 🇲🇽

1 documento

1 / 13

Toggle sidebar

Esta página no es visible en la vista previa

¡No te pierdas las partes importantes!

bg1
de Herramientas Computacionales
Facultad de Ingeniería Eléctrica
Prof. Mauricio Reyes
Laboratorio
pf3
pf4
pf5
pf8
pf9
pfa
pfd

Vista previa parcial del texto

¡Descarga iNTRODUCCION A HERRAMIENTAS COMPUTACIONALES y más Diapositivas en PDF de Computación aplicada solo en Docsity!

de Herramientas Computacionales

Facultad de Ingeniería Eléctrica

Prof. Mauricio Reyes

Laboratorio

CONTENIDOS 01 02 04 03 Software Libre & GNU/Linux Entorno Grafico Linea de Comandos Aplicaciones para Ingeniería

01 FREE SOFTWARE o Software Libre El término FREE, es muy ambiguo ya que significa libre o gratis (términos más comunes), de acuerdo con la definición que dio la Free Software Fundation (1984) , es el software que da al usuario la oportunidad de estudiarlo, modificarlos y compartirlo ya que se considera que el usuario es “LIBRE”. El que se agregue el término FREE no es necesariamente que tenga que ser un software totalmente gratis, sino que es un software totalmente apegado a la “LIBERTAD”. Cuando hablamos de Software Libre está implícito la garantía de las siguientes cuatro libertades: Libertad 0: Libertad de usar el programa, con cualquier propósito. Libertad 1: Libertad de estudiar como funciona el programa, modificarlo y adaptarlo a nuestras necesidades. Libertad 2: Libertad de distribuir copias del programa con lo cual puedes ayudar a tu prójimo. Libertad 3: Libertad de mejorar el programa y hacer públicas esas mejoras a los demas, de modo que toda la comunidad se beneficie.

1 3 0 2 nos da la posibilidad de ver de como mejorar el software para el beneficio de la comunidad y estas modificaciones exponerlas a la comunidad para que otro las pueda estudiar y tal vez mejorarlas. nos da la posibilidad de poder ver el código fuente, estudiarlo, ver su funcionamiento y saber como hace lo que hace, además de poder adaptarlo a nuestras necesidades particulares. nos da la libertad de distribuir este software sea por el medio que sea y con o sin costo (generalmente cuando es con costo es el costo de la distribución, no un costo por “comprar” el software). implica que el usuario puede usar el software de cualquier manera que lo desee. 01 Las libertades 1 y 3 requieren el código fuente.

01 OPEN SOURCE o Código Abierto. Este término nace en 1998 y tiene un punto de vista más orientado a los beneficios de la practicidad de compartir los códigos que a las cuestiones morales que presenta el SF. El Open Source esta referido a la posibilidad de ver el código fuente del programa para que este evoluciones, mejore y se desarrolle según las necesidades de los usuarios. Esto permite que los errores o bugs se corrijan de manera más rápida que si lo hiciera una compañía de software privativo y por ende una producción de software mejor. el Código abierto también tiene una serie de requisitos que cumplir para poder ser considerado Código abierto: Libre redistribución: el software debe poder ser regalado o vendido libremente. Código fuente: el código fuente debe estar incluido u obtenerse libremente. Trabajos derivados: la redistribución de modificaciones debe estar permitida. Integridad del código fuente del autor: las licencias pueden requerir que las modificaciones sean redistribuidas sólo como parches. Sin discriminación de personas o grupos: nadie puede dejarse fuera. Sin discriminación de áreas de iniciativa: los usuarios comerciales no pueden ser excluidos. Distribución de la licencia: deben aplicarse los mismos derechos a todo el que reciba el programa La licencia no debe ser específica de un producto: el programa no puede licenciarse solo como parte de una distribución mayor. La licencia no debe restringir otro software: la licencia no puede obligar a que algún otro software que sea distribuido con el software abierto deba también ser de código abierto. La licencia debe ser tecnológicamente neutral: no debe requerirse la aceptación de la licencia por medio de un acceso por clic de ratón o de otra forma específica del medio de soporte del software.

01 FOSS o FLOSS

01

01

01 APPS SOFTWARE LIBRE https://www.timetoast.com/timelines/linea-del-tiempo-de-linux-a624b178-2067-47ea-8ad1-5bbb802d